Somewhat major feature amusingly buried down in the latest system update notes:
https://en-americas-support.nintend...system-update-information-for-nintendo-switch
Added “Handheld Mode Boost” to Nintendo Switch Software Handling in System.
  • Handheld Mode Boost will cause compatible Switch software to run as if in TV Mode, so certain functionality may be affected. Please see the on-device description for more details.
So if you had a game that was a bit rough looking cause the scaling or rendered/output was pretty low res handheld, this should help quite a bit.

I wish they'd made it a bit easier to access, but this is fantastic for older games that are likely to never get any kind of Switch 2 patch. It makes Sword and Shield actually look decent in handheld, for example (instead of being a blocky mess, because those games didn't even run at native res on the Switch 1 in handheld most of the time).

Hopefully a future update will add a switch to the quick settings popup that comes up when you hold the Home button. There's no reason for this to be buried as deep as it is (it's near the bottom of the System menu, which itself is at the bottom of the settings screen); games don't seem to have trouble transitioning in and out of boost mode even while running (which makes sense; it's the same as a transition in or out of the dock from the point of view of the game).
